The user manual says you can use the keyless entry remotes to remember the temp control settings for the driver, but it doesn't give any explanation on how it works. How does this work? Does it just recall the previous settings for the remote that was used to lock the doors?

If you look on the back of the remotes, you will see a "1" and a "2". These correspond to each driver, and the receiver in the truck (BCM and LGM) know which is which. If you have memory seats, you will have a 1 and 2 button on the driver door pod, which sets all the personalization for each person. It remembers the seat, rearview mirrors, heater control, and radio presets for each driver.

Set your desired temp setting and withe the vehicle started pess and hold the unlock button on the key fob.This sets the tempeature memory.
